WPI's Aladdin High Pressure Single Syringe Pump is often used in research where precise, controlled delivery of fluids at elevated pressures is required. High-pressure syringe pumps can be used in chemical synthesis processes requiring precise control over the addition of reagents. This is especially important in reactions that occur under high pressures, such as certain types of catalytic reactions or polymerization processes.
These high pressure Aladdin pumps hold a single syringe up to 140 mL (a 200mL syringe partly filled). They can infuse from 1.733 µL/hr with a 1mL syringe up to 340.6 mL/min with a 140 mL syringe. With all the advanced function and programming features of the Aladdin series of syringe pumps, you can choose between 100 lb. (AL-1000HP) and 200 lb.(AL-10000HP2) force.

High-pressure syringe pumps can also be utilized in biological and biochemical research for controlled delivery of solutions, such as high-pressure cell lysis, protein folding studies, or studies involving high-pressure biophysical techniques. Researchers studying catalysis, especially those focusing on heterogeneous catalysis, may use high-pressure syringe pumps to deliver reactants at controlled rates and pressures. This is important for understanding and optimizing catalytic processes. In microfluidics research, where small volumes of fluids are manipulated, high-pressure syringe pumps can be used to precisely control the flow of fluids through microchannels and devices.

Mechanical & Electrical
| SYRINGE SIZES | Plastic syringes up to 60mL; selected glass micro syringes from 0.5-500 uL |
| NUMBER OF SYRINGES | 1 |
| MOTOR TYPE | Step Motor, 1/8 to 1/2 step modes |
| STEPS PER REVOLUTIONS | 200 |
| STEPPING (max. min.) | 0.425µm (1/8 stepping) to 1.701µm (1/2 stepping) |
| MOTOR TO DRIVE SCREW RATIO | 15/28 |
| SPEED (max./min.) | 18.4 cm/min / 0.0084 cm/hr |
| PUMPING RATES | 6120 mL/hr with 60 mL syringe, to 1.459 µL/hr with 1 mL syringe |
| MAXIMUM FORCE | 100 lb. at min. speed, 18 lb. at max. speed |
| NUMBER OF PROGRAM PHASES | 41 |
| RS-232 PUMP NETWORK | 100 pumps maximum |
| POWER supply | Wall adapter 12 V DC @ 850 mA |
| DIMENSIONS | 22.9 x 14.6 x 11.4 cm (8.75 x 5.75 x 4.5 in.) |
| WEIGHT | 1.6 kg (3.6 lb.) |

Mechanical & Electrical
| DRIVE BLOCK TYPE | Solid (Must use Purge Function to move pusher block) |
| MOTOR TYPE | Step motor |
| MOTOR STEP/REVOLUTION | 200 |
| MOTOR TO DRIVE SCREW RATIO | 14/22 |
| DRIVE SCREW PITCH | 20 revolutions/" |
| POWER SUPPLY TYPE | External, country and power specific |
| POWER SUPPLY OUTPUT RATING | 24V DC @ 1200mA |
| POWER CONNECTOR | 2.1 mm, center positive, DC |
| VOLTAGE AT POWER CONNECTOR | 24V DC at full load |
| AMPERAGE | 1200mA at full load |
| DIMENSIONS | 11 1/4" x 6 1/8" x 6 3/8" (LxWxH) |
| WEIGHT | 7.8125 lbs (3.55lkg) |
Operational
| MAX FORCE | 200 LBS |
| MICRO-STEPPING | 1/8 to 1/1 depending on motor speed |
| ADVANCE PER STEP | 0.50511364 um to 4.040909 um depending on motor speed |
| MAX SPEED | 30.033 cm/min |
| MIN SPEED | 0.00998882 cm/hr |
| MAX PUMPING RATE | 340.6 mL/min with a 140mL syringe |
| MIN PUMPING RATE | 1.733 uL/hr with B-D 1 mL syringe |
| SYRINGE INSIDE DIAMETER RANGE | 0.100 to 50.00 mm |
| NUMBER OF PROGRAM PHASES | 41 |
| RS-232 PUMP NETWORK | 100 pumps MAX |
| RS-232 SELECTABLE BAUD RATES | 300, 1200, 2400, 9600, 19200 |

Laboratory syringes are used for accurate measurement and administration of fluids in medical, laboratory, and industrial settings. Proper maintenance is crucial to ensure their functionality and accuracy. Here we will examine some common maintenance issues you may encounter with your reusable laboratory syringes.
Cleaning laboratory syringes helps prevent contamination and ensures accurate dosing. You should always adhere to the protocols of your institution and the manufacturer of your syringe. Specific cleaning requirements may vary based on the intended use of the syringe, its material composition , and the sample fluid introduced.
